Re: [PATCH v2 4/4] drm/msm/dsi/phy: Define PHY_CMN_CLK_CFG[01] bitfields and simplify saving

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



On Tue, Feb 04, 2025 at 10:24:28AM +0100, Krzysztof Kozlowski wrote:
> On 03/02/2025 18:58, Dmitry Baryshkov wrote:
> > On Mon, Feb 03, 2025 at 06:29:21PM +0100, Krzysztof Kozlowski wrote:
> >> Add bitfields for PHY_CMN_CLK_CFG0 and PHY_CMN_CLK_CFG1 registers to
> >> avoid hard-coding bit masks and shifts and make the code a bit more
> >> readable.  While touching the lines in dsi_7nm_pll_save_state()
> >> resulting cached->pix_clk_div assignment would be too big, so just
> >> combine pix_clk_div and bit_clk_div into one cached state to make
> >> everything simpler.
